  • A timely examination of the ways in which prime ministers manage and fail to manage their public communication.

  • Original in scope, covering political rumours, political cartoons and capital cities, in addition to more familiar topics.

  • Sets contemporary analysis of Downing Street press secretaries, media barons and press conferences in fuller historical context than usual.

  • Draws on public records, private papers and interviews by the author dating back to the 1960s.
